Detailed Itinerary
Arrive at Bagdogra Airport (IXB) or New Jalpaiguri Railway Station (NJP) and embark on a scenic drive to Gangtok, the capital of Sikkim. Check into your hotel and spend the afternoon at leisure, perhaps strolling along MG Marg, the vibrant pedestrian street. Enjoy the local atmosphere, sample some Sikkimese delicacies, and prepare for the adventures ahead in this beautiful hill station.
Embark on a full day of sightseeing in and around Gangtok. Visit the Enchey Monastery, a significant Nyingma monastery, and the Namgyal Institute of Tibetology, showcasing rare Buddhist scriptures and artifacts. Explore the Directorate of Handicrafts & Handloom to admire local crafts. Conclude your day with a peaceful visit to the serene Do Drul Chorten Stupa, reflecting the rich Buddhist heritage of the region.
After an early breakfast, begin your picturesque journey to Lachung, a charming village nestled in North Sikkim. The route offers breathtaking views of waterfalls, rugged mountains, and lush valleys. En route, stop at Singhik viewpoint and the picturesque Chumthang. Check into your hotel upon arrival in Lachung, a gateway to some of Sikkim's most stunning landscapes, and prepare for the high-altitude wonders tomorrow.
Today is an exhilarating day as you venture to Yumthang Valley, also known as the 'Valley of Flowers,' (seasonal bloom). Continue further to Zero Point (subject to road conditions and permit), offering panoramic views of snow-capped peaks and often covered in snow. After soaking in the majestic beauty, return to Lachung for lunch and then proceed back to Gangtok, reflecting on the spectacular landscapes of North Sikkim.
Embark on an exciting excursion to the Indo-China border region (subject to permits and weather conditions). Visit the sacred Tsomgo Lake, a glacial lake revered by locals, where you can enjoy yak rides. Continue to Baba Harbhajan Singh Mandir, a shrine dedicated to an Indian army soldier. If permits are obtained and the pass is open, experience the historic Nathula Pass, offering unique cross-border views.
After breakfast, depart from Gangtok and head towards the 'Queen of Hills,' Darjeeling. Enjoy a scenic drive through winding roads and lush green tea gardens. Upon arrival, check into your hotel and take some time to relax. In the afternoon, consider visiting a local tea estate to witness the tea-making process and enjoy a refreshing cup of Darjeeling's famous brew amidst stunning panoramic views.
Rise early to catch a mesmerizing sunrise over the Kanchenjunga peaks from Tiger Hill. On your way back, visit the Ghoom Monastery and the Batasia Loop. Spend the rest of the day exploring Darjeeling's charm, including the Himalayan Mountaineering Institute (HMI), the Darjeeling Zoo, and a joy ride on the iconic Darjeeling Himalayan Railway (Toy Train), a UNESCO World Heritage site.
Enjoy a leisurely breakfast in Darjeeling, perhaps revisiting your favorite spot for one last view of the Himalayas. Depending on your flight or train schedule, you might have time for some last-minute souvenir shopping at the local markets. Afterwards, you will be transferred to Bagdogra Airport (IXB) or New Jalpaiguri Railway Station (NJP) for your onward journey, carrying cherished memories of Sikkim and Darjeeling.
